What are rhododendron plants and why are they popular in gardens?
Rhododendron plants are flowering shrubs and small trees known for their large, colorful blooms and long-lasting foliage. They are popular because they provide strong seasonal interest, thrive in shaded landscapes, and add structure to gardens year-round.
Are these rhododendron plants for sale suitable for native landscapes?
Yes, this collection focuses on native rhododendron varieties that naturally adapt to regional climates. Native rhododendron plants integrate well into woodland gardens and support local ecosystems.
When is the best time to plant rhododendron plants
The best time to plant rhododendron plants is in early spring or fall. These seasons allow the roots to establish before extreme heat or cold, improving long-term growth and flowering performance.
Do rhododendron plants require full sun or shade?
Most rhododendron plants prefer partial shade. Morning sun with afternoon protection helps prevent leaf scorching while encouraging healthy flowering.
What soil conditions do the rhododendrons need to grow well?
Rhododendrons grow best in well-drained, slightly acidic soil. Good drainage is essential to prevent root problems and support strong plant development.
How large does a rhododendron shrub typically grow?
A rhododendron shrub can range from compact forms around three feet tall to larger varieties that develop into a rhododendron tree form reaching ten feet or more over time.
Are rhododendron plants for sale suitable for container gardening?
Some rhododendron plants can be grown in large containers, especially small varieties. Containers must have proper drainage and an acidic soil to maintain plant health.
What colors of rhododendron flowers are available?
Rhododendron flowers are available in a wide range of colors including purple rhododendron, red rhododendron, white rhododendron, pink, and soft lavender shades, depending on the variety.
How often do rhododendron plants bloom?
Most rhododendrons bloom once a year in spring. The flowering period can last several weeks, depending on weather conditions and plant maturity.
Are rhododendron plants evergreen or deciduous?
Rhododendron plants can be either evergreen or deciduous, depending on the species. Native rhododendron varieties are evergreen, providing year-round foliage interest.
How much maintenance do rhododendron plants require?
Rhododendron plants are considered low maintenance once established. Occasional watering during dry periods and light pruning after flowering are usually sufficient.
Can I buy rhododendrons as a hedge or screen?
Yes, rhododendron shrubs are commonly used as informal hedges or privacy screens. Their dense growth and evergreen foliage make them effective for natural boundaries.
Are rhododendron plants safe for pollinators?
Yes, native rhododendron plants support pollinators such as bees during their flowering season, making them a valuable addition to pollinator-friendly gardens.
How long do rhododendron plants live?
With proper care, rhododendron plants can live for decades. Mature plants often become more attractive over time, producing fuller growth and more abundant blooms.

🌤️ Growing Conditions for Healthy Performance

Native rhododendrons grow best in conditions close to their natural habitat:

  • Partial shade with afternoon sun protection
  • Slightly acidic, well-drained soil
  • Consistent moisture while establishing

Once established, these plants offer steady, dependable growth and longer life spans compared to many non-native hybrids.
